LevelUp Degree
Art & Design

What Degrees Are Best for User Interface Design?

The landscape of UI design intertwines artistic sensibility with technical proficiency, making education a crucial piece of the puzzle.

What Degrees Are Best for User Interface Design?

In the rapidly evolving world of digital interfaces, the question of what degree programs best prepare one for a career in user interface design is a good one. The landscape of UI design intertwines artistic sensibility with technical proficiency, making education a crucial piece of the puzzle. The amalgamation of computer science, design theory, psychology, and several other fields forms the bedrock for creating intuitive and aesthetically pleasing interfaces.

Understanding the spectrum from coding to cognitive science reveals the interdisciplinary nature of UI design. Each facet of education—from human-computer interaction to digital communications—contributes uniquely to the preparation of a versatile and insightful UI designer. Whether you're drawn to the intricacies of code or the study of human behavior, each discipline offers its own set of skills vital for mastering the user interface domain.

This article investigates the myriad educational paths one can embark on to excel in the UI design industry. By dissecting degrees in computer science, graphic design, and even anthropology, we aim to highlight the strengths and applications of each in sculpting a successful career in the creation and optimization of user interfaces. Let's look at the arguments for each academic direction, weighing their contributions in equipping future designers with the right toolkit for crafting user-centric digital experiences.

Computer Science or Programming

When it comes to choosing the best degree for User Interface (UI) Design, a degree in Computer Science or Programming can be highly beneficial. These degrees provide a foundational understanding of software development, which is crucial for UI designers as they often need to work closely with developers and understand the technical constraints and possibilities of digital products. Computer Science degrees typically cover a range of topics that are relevant to UI design, including algorithmic thinking, data structures, and software engineering principles.

Furthermore, a programming-focused education helps UI designers build prototypes and understand the backend systems that will drive the user interfaces they design. This technical background also allows UI designers to communicate more effectively with development teams and contribute to solving complex problems in the design of mobile apps, responsive design for websites, and other digital interfaces.

Importance of Technical Skills

In the realm of UI design, technical skills are invaluable. While the role of a UI designer is predominantly creative, possessing a deep understanding of the technical aspects can dramatically improve the feasibility and functionality of designs. For those with a background in programming or computer science, the transition from conceptual designs to usable products is more streamlined owing to their grasp of how systems work.

Technical skills enable designers to make informed decisions about layout, interactivity, and the overall user experience. Moreover, proficient use of design tools and software is necessary to bring the interfaces from concept to reality. Experienced designers will attest that understanding coding languages can greatly affect the quality of their work and their ability to execute design thinking effectively.

Programming Languages for UI Design

While UI designers are not typically required to code extensively, familiarity with languages such as HTML, CSS, and JavaScript is important, as these are the building blocks of web and many mobile applications. They help designers understand the limitations and capabilities of the web and facilitate the creation of prototypes that closely mirror the final product. Here's a brief overview of their importance:

  • HTML (HyperText Markup Language): Fundamental for creating the structure of web pages. It is the scaffold upon which design elements are placed.
  • CSS (Cascading Style Sheets): Essential for styling the visual appearance of web elements. It helps in achieving the desired look and feel, as well as implementing responsive design practices.
  • JavaScript: Enables interactivity and dynamic content within a website or app. It plays a pivotal role in enhancing the functionality of UI elements.

Beyond these, familiarity with backend languages such as Python or Ruby may also enhance a UI designer's ability to understand the full scope of product design.

Understanding Software Development and Implementation

A thorough understanding of the software development process is critical for UI designers. This knowledge goes beyond just creating visually appealing elements; it encompasses the awareness of how design integrates into functional, user-friendly interfaces. By understanding the lifecycle of software development—from requirements gathering, design, coding, testing, to deployment—UI designers can ensure their design jobs are not only about aesthetics but also usability and efficiency.

Moreover, understanding implementation helps in anticipating potential design issues early on, leading to less rework and a more cohesive product. Interaction with software developers becomes smoother when a UI designer can speak their language and appreciate the complexities involved in turning designs into live applications.

Human-Computer Interaction

Human-Computer Interaction (HCI) is an interdisciplinary field that marries computer science, behavioral sciences, and design to ensure that digital products are user-friendly and accessible. At its core, HCI is about understanding how humans interact with technology and how design can improve this interaction. Degrees focusing on HCI provide students with insights into cognitive psychology, design methodologies, and the technical aspects of designing interactive systems. By studying HCI, aspiring user interface designers develop a deep understanding of the user's needs, behaviors, and how to create interfaces that are intuitive and enhance the user's experience with technology.

Importance of understanding user behavior

Grasping user behavior is pivotal for user interface designers as it lays the foundation for creating interfaces that are easy to use and meet the users' needs. An in-depth understanding of user behavior helps designers predict how users might interact with a product, leading to designs that facilitate a seamless user experience. Factors such as cognitive load, user expectations, and behaviors are all considered in the design process to make products more intuitive and easier to navigate. When designers understand the users' behaviors, they can anticipate potential problems and design interactions that are more gratifying and less frustrating for the user.

User research and usability testing

User research and usability testing are instrumental practices in HCI and UI design to ensure products are developed with the user in mind. By conducting user research, designers are able to gather valuable insights about the user's needs, preferences, and the context in which the digital product will be used. Usability testing, on the other hand, is an evaluative approach where real users interact with the product to identify areas of friction and confusion. Designers use these findings to refine and iterate their designs, ultimately leading to a more user-friendly product. These practices help designers build empathy with users and tailor the user interface to cater to their specific needs.

Design principles for effective interaction

There are several design principles critical to creating effective interactions within user interfaces. These principles guide designers in crafting experiences that are not only aesthetically pleasing but also functional and efficient. Key principles include:

  • Consistency: Ensuring the interface has a uniform look and interaction patterns across different parts of the application.
  • Feedback: Providing users with immediate and clear feedback in response to their actions.
  • Affordance: Designing elements in a way that suggests how they should be used.
  • Visibility: Keeping important information and controls in view without overwhelming the user with too much information at once.
  • Simplicity: Striving for simplicity to reduce the cognitive load on users, making the interface easy to understand and use.

These principles, grounded in the discipline of HCI, help designers create more user-friendly and engaging interfaces, ultimately enhancing the overall user experience.

Graphic Design

Graphic Design is a discipline that combines art and technology to communicate ideas through images and the layout of web screens and printed pages. Graphic designers use various design elements to achieve artistic or decorative effects. They work on a range of products, including brand logos, websites, mobile apps, product packaging, marketing materials, and more. A fundamental understanding of graphic design principles is essential for professionals aiming to specialize in user interface design, as it provides the foundation for creating visually appealing and effective designs.

With the pervasiveness of digital products, graphic design has become increasingly important in the field of User Interface Design. Skilled graphic designers can bridge the gap between a product's intent and its visual realization, making them key players in the development of successful digital interfaces.

Importance of visual communication skills

Visual communication skills are paramount for UI designers, as they enable them to convey complex information in an understandable and engaging way. These skills encompass the ability to create graphics that can guide users, inform them, and evoke the desired emotional response. User Interface designers must master visual communication to ensure that users find the digital products they create not only aesthetically pleasing but also intuitive and user-friendly.

For UI designers, visual communication skills extend beyond just the technical ability to create designs; they must also have a deep understanding of user psychology and the principles of design thinking. This knowledge helps them to craft user interfaces that speak directly to users' needs and enhance their overall experience with the product.

Principles of visual design

The principles of visual design really spell out the necessary elements for successful design composition. They include balance, which distributes elements evenly in a design; contrast, which utilizes differing shapes, sizes, and colors to highlight importance and draw attention; alignment, which creates a sharper, more unified layout; repetition, which ties together consistent elements such as logos and colors; and hierarchy, which leads the viewer through each element of the design in order of its significance.

These principles of visual design are crucial for UI designers to create coherent and aesthetically pleasing interfaces. By applying these key concepts, designers craft interfaces that are not only visually attractive but also structured in a manner that naturally guides the user through the design, enabling a smooth and cohesive experience across the entire platform.

Typography and color theory

Typography and color theory are essential components of graphic design that have profound effects on the usability and aesthetic appeal of a user interface. Typography involves the art of arranging type to make the text legible, readable, and appealing when displayed. It encompasses font selection, line length, spacing, and size which are critical in designing readable interfaces that communicate the intended message effectively.

Color theory, on the other hand, is the study of color in art and design, with an emphasis on color mixing, the visual effects of specific color combinations, and the psychological impact colors have on viewers. In UI Design, the understanding of color theory is crucial in creating palettes that enhance user engagement, denote interactivity, and reinforce brand identity. Together, typography and color theory empower user interface designers to create aesthetically compelling and functionally superior digital products.

Industrial Design

Industrial Design is a professional practice that focuses on the design and development of physical products. Industrial designers are trained to consider the form, function, and user experience in tandem when creating new products. The discipline spans a wide range of product categories, from household items and furniture to technological devices and vehicles. The goal is to produce items that are not only attractive but also practical, sustainable, and suited to the needs of users.

Designers use a variety of tools and methodologies to bring their concepts to life, including sketching, 3D modeling, and using design software. Working in close collaboration with engineers, marketers, and manufacturers, industrial designers have a significant influence on how products are made, how they function, and how they deliver experiences to consumers. The knowledge of materials, production processes, and an understanding of market trends are essential for success in industrial design roles.

Ergonomics and user-centered design

Ergonomics is the study of people's efficiency in their working environment, crucial in the context of product design to enhance user comfort and prevent injury or strain. Industrial design closely integrates with ergonomics as designers strive to tailor products to fit the human body and its movement.

User-centered design is a process that places the user at the forefront of product development. It involves an iterative process of ideation, prototyping, testing, and refining to ensure the final product meets the actual needs and limitations of end-users. With ergonomics in mind, designers conduct user research, create user personas, and perform usability testing to derive insights that drive the development of products that are both functional and easy to use.

Incorporating aesthetics and functionality

A key challenge for industrial designers is merging the aesthetic aspects of product design with functionality. While a product must perform its intended purpose effectively, visual appeal is a significant factor in consumer choice. Designers are tasked with creating products that not only look good but also resonate emotionally with users.

Achieving a balance between aesthetics and functionality involves selecting appropriate materials, colors, and finishes, as well as ensuring the product's form supports its function. For example, a sleek and minimalist look might align with a product's brand identity while user interface elements must be designed to be easily accessible and operable. Industrial designers must juggle numerous design principles to produce a product that stands out in the market for all the right reasons.

By incorporating considerations of ergonomics, user interface design, and aesthetics, industrial designers play a vital role in the creation of products that are enjoyable and satisfying to use, meeting the real-world demands of consumers with style and innovation.

Anthropology

Anthropology, the study of human societies, cultures, and their development, is a discipline that offers critical insights into understanding various user groups. At its core, anthropology examines the ways in which people live, interact, and construct meaning within their communities and the wider society. This broad exploration encompasses different aspects like customs, values, norms, and social patterns, all of which are essential in the context of user interface design. Recognizing and integrating these anthropological elements can result in more inclusive, effective, and culturally appropriate design solutions.

Importance of Cultural Understanding in Design

User interface design is not just about aesthetics and functionality; it's also about context. A profound cultural understanding can make the difference between a product that resonates with users and one that falls flat. Designers must acknowledge that each user brings a unique set of cultural backgrounds to their interactions with digital products. As such, user interface designers must adopt a culturally sensitive approach, taking into account language, customs, aesthetics, symbolism, and other cultural nuances to create interfaces that are truly user-centered and globally relevant. By doing so, they not only enhance the user experience but also help avoid unintended offenses or misunderstandings.

Ethnographic Research Methods

Ethnographic research methods serve as a bridge between cultural understanding and practical design. This approach involves immersive observation and interaction within the user's natural environment. Ethnographic methods often include:

  • Participant observation
  • Interviews
  • Surveys
  • Use of artifacts
  • Cultural immersion

This user-centered research allows designers to gain an intimate glimpse into the lives and experiences of their target audience. By engaging directly with users, designers can uncover the deeper needs, motivations, and behavioral patterns, which can inform more empathic and effective user interface designs.

Designing for Diverse User Groups

Designing for diverse user groups requires a multifaceted strategy that embraces the complexity of various cultural contexts. A successful design for a global audience should be both accessible and inclusive, providing a wide range of users with a positive experience. Some key considerations for designing across diverse user groups include:

  • Languages: Multilingual interfaces that cater to different language speakers.
  • Accessibility: Design elements that consider disabilities and limitations, ensuring usability for all.
  • Cultural Appropriateness: Imagery, color choices, and other visual elements that are appropriate and respectful of cultural norms.

A designer's ability to craft a user interface that respects and reflects this myriad of cultural dimensions is critical for the global reach and success of digital products. Continued education, such as online courses and professional workshops, can aid designers to stay abreast of best practices in this area.

Designers' readiness to embrace cultural diversity and apply these understandings can lead to UI designs that not only stand out but are also warmly welcomed by users from around the world.

Digital Communications and Multimedia

In the digital age, communications and multimedia have become intertwined in a way that both enhances and challenges the way we connect and convey messages. Digital communications encompass various platforms and mediums—from social media to mobile apps—where users interact and engage with content. Multimedia is integral to this engagement, encompassing text, audio, video, and interactive elements adeptly crafted to capture the audience's attention. Skilled practitioners in this domain are expected to have a deep understanding of content strategies, design tools, and how to create digital products that resonate with diverse audiences. Being adept at employing multimedia elements not only enriches the user experience but also ensures that communication is effective, appealing, and accessible across different demographics.

Importance of Effective Communication Strategies

Effective communication strategies are vital in ensuring that multimedia content is well-received and achieves its intended purpose. This involves understanding the target audience's preferences, the context in which the message will be consumed, and the objectives of the communication effort. A successful strategy should combine clarity of message with an appropriate mix of multimedia elements to create engaging and persuasive content. It requires ongoing analysis and adaptation in response to audience feedback and evolving digital trends.

Key components of an effective communication strategy for multimedia include:

  • Clear, concise messaging tailored to specific audience segments
  • Adaptable content that resonates across different cultural contexts
  • Strategic use of visual design and interaction design to enhance user engagement
  • Responsive design to ensure optimal viewing across various devices

Multimedia Production and Editing Skills

Creating high-quality multimedia content demands a specific set of skills related to production and editing. These skills enable creators to manipulate various media forms to produce a cohesive and impactful narrative. For designers and content creators, these skills include:

  • Proficiency in design software for creating and editing graphics and visual elements
  • Video and audio production capabilities, including recording, editing, and post-production
  • Understanding of animation and motion graphics to add dynamic layers to content
  • Skills to create interactive experiences, such as gamification elements or dynamic infographics

To effectively execute production and editing tasks, experience with popular design and multimedia tools, such as Adobe Creative Suite, is advantageous. Additionally, keeping abreast of advancements in software and techniques is essential for continued growth and effectiveness in the field.

Web Design and Digital Content Creation

In web design and digital content creation, professionals are tasked with not only presenting information but also crafting experiences that are intuitive and captivating. This facet of user interface design is especially significant as websites and digital platforms are often the first point of interaction between a business and its clients. The role of a designer here is multifaceted, requiring a mix of:

  • Technical skills, such as HTML, CSS, and JavaScript for building the structure and implementing design elements
  • Aesthetic sensibility to ensure visual appeal through layout, typography, and color palettes
  • Content strategies that prioritize SEO and user engagement to elevate the digital presence

Web design and digital content creation go hand-in-hand with the development of professional portfolios, showcasing a designer’s capacity to produce digital products that are not just visually stunning but also functionally robust and user-friendly. It's about connecting with the user at every digital touchpoint, optimizing the user's journey through intuitive navigation and coherent, engaging content.

Specialized UX Design Major

For aspiring user interface designers seeking formal education, a specialized major in UX (User Experience) Design can be a perfect starting point. This degree encompasses crucial elements of interaction design, visual design, and user experience design. It arms students with the technical skills and theoretical knowledge necessary to enter the competitive field of UI/UX design. Most specialized UX degrees will cover topics ranging from the fundamentals of graphic design to the complexities of human-computer interaction and Industrial Design. These programs are structured to help students acquire a deep understanding of the user-centered design process and prepare a professional portfolio that showcases their practical experience.

Comprehensive education in UX design and user experience

A comprehensive education in UX design and user experience includes an interdisciplinary approach that marries design thinking with hands-on practice. Curriculum in this area often covers:

  • Interaction Design: Principles of designing engaging interfaces for digital products, including mobile apps and websites.
  • Visual Design: Exploring color theory, typography, and layout for crafting visually appealing and functional interfaces.
  • Human-Computer Interaction: Understanding how users interact with computers and designing interfaces that accommodate these behaviors.
  • Product Design: Incorporating strategies for designing products that meet user needs while aligning with business objectives.
  • Responsive Design: Creating UIs that adapt and function seamlessly across different devices and screen sizes.

Additionally, students learn to work with various design tools and technologies, enabling them to create high-fidelity prototypes and engaging digital content.

User experience research and analysis

User experience research and analysis are pivotal in understanding user needs and behaviors. Degrees with a focus on UX design emphasize:

  • Qualitative and Quantitative Research: Methods to gather insights about user preferences and actions through surveys, interviews, and usability tests.
  • Analytical Skills: Interpreting data to inform design decisions and ensure user interfaces are intuitive and accessible.
  • Layouts and Structures: Designing information hierarchies and navigation schemas that facilitate user tasks and information discovery.

This education component ensures that future designers can conduct effective research to back up their design choices.

Prototyping and wireframing

Prototyping and wireframing are essential skills for user interface designers, enabling them to visualize and test concepts before proceeding to high-fidelity designs. Coursework often includes:

  • Wireframe Creation: Using low-fidelity representations to outline the structure and components of a UI.
  • Interactive Prototyping: Building functional mockups to demonstrate and test user flows and interactive elements.
  • Design Software Proficiency: Training in industry-standard tools such as Sketch, Adobe XD, and Figma for creating prototypes.

This experiential learning prepares students to iterate quickly and efficiently during the design process.

Usability testing and iteration

A degree with a concentration in user interface design usually encompasses usability testing and iterative design practices. Students learn how to:

  • Conduct Usability Tests: Organizing sessions where actual users interact with prototypes, providing valuable feedback on functionality and design.
  • Iterative Design: Using insights from testing to refine and improve UI designs in multiple cycles, enhancing the user experience with each revision.
  • Communication Skills: Presenting findings and discussing design changes effectively with stakeholders and team members.

The focus on usability testing and iteration ensures that graduates can create products that aren’t only visually appealing but also user-friendly and practical.

Level Up with the Right Degree

Hopefully this long article provided some helpful direction to discovering the best degrees for beginning a career in User Interface Design. To narrow down your search to a specific starting point, think about which of these directions appeals most to you and what kinds of design skills you are most interested in learning. When you're ready to get started, don't wait too long. Find a school with a degree program that's the best fit for you.